Fun, simple and very inexpensive, painting on glass is great fun and perfect for recycling glass bottles and jars. Different size jars can be used differently; for vases, "gifts in a jar" projects, bath salts, pencil holders, Q-tips or cotton balls, sewing kits, potpourri, cosmetic brushes, individual coffee, tea, or sweetener packets, and using your imagination I'm sure you could come up with many more. With her simple sweet apron, slouched socks, and her little pigtails, Emma is a simple country girl who stands approximately 15 inches tall. Made from coffee & vanilla stained muslin, her hair is 4-ply yarn, apron is embroidered with a simple back stitch, socks from a vintage handkerchief, and her shoes are painted. With a line of stitching at her knees, she can sit perfectly on a shelf.
